有机硫化合物是指含有硫原子的有机化合物。这些化合物在自然界中广泛存在,在医药、农药和材料科学等领域有着重要的应用。有机硫化合物因其化学性质独特,在药物设计、合成化学以及材料制备方面扮演着重要角色。
